I used the two larger dies in my set of stitched rectangles to create the frame for my shaker card. I used the new patterned paper, Fun Foam and Stick It to create a raised frame that was super easy to assemble. I basically attached the Fun Foam to the patterned paper with the Stick It. This is my first time trying this out and I found that it is truly the easiest and most mistake-proof way to do it. I then adhered acetate that was cut with the larger of the two rectangle dies and then another layer of fun foam went on top of that. Basically the acetate is sandwiched between the two layers of Fun Foam and the patterned paper is adhered to the top layer of Fun Foam! I created the “dream” sentiment using the Fun Foam and Stick it with some Neenah cardstock. They were all layered on top of each other, cut out with the “dream” die from Whimsy and then I just covered over top of the card-stock with some Copic Markers. The same ones I used to color the mermaid’s tail.
